- Ispezione: Ciò comporta la revisione manuale del codice per verificare la presenza di errori relativi alla logica, alla sintassi e alla formattazione e alla garanzia che vengano seguiti gli standard e le migliori pratiche.
- Revisione del codice: Ciò comporta revisioni tra pari per individuare errori di codifica e incoerenze prima che il codice venga effettivamente testato.
- Analisi statica: È una tecnica di analisi automatizzata del codice eseguita sul codice sorgente del programma senza compilarlo. Consente di analizzare il codice per individuare difetti come codifica non standard o non sicura, codice morto, istruzioni irraggiungibili, ecc.
- Test della scatola bianca: Questo è un tipo di test strutturale che prevede il test osservando il funzionamento interno del sistema invece di limitarsi a testare gli input e gli output esterni.
- Test unitario: Nel test unitario, ciascuna unità di codice (ad esempio, funzione o metodo) viene esaminata in modo indipendente per verificare se l'unità soddisfa i requisiti.
- Test di integrazione: Nei test di integrazione, i moduli o le unità che hanno superato i test unitari vengono combinati e testati per identificare i difetti relativi all'interfaccia e alle dipendenze.
networking © www.354353.com